Mufasa Box Office Update: The highly anticipated prequel to Disney's The Lion King, titled Mufasa, has made a grand entrance at the Indian box office, amassing a commendable Rs 8.5–9 crore on its opening day. The performance of Shah Rukh Khan's Hindi dub and Mahesh Babu's Telugu version were standout contributors to this success, marking a significant achievement for Hollywood family entertainers in India. This opening nearly matches 80 percent of the first-day earnings of The Lion King in 2019, which was Rs 11.10 crore, showcasing India's growing market strength for such films.
Significantly, the dubbed versions of Mufasa have been instrumental in its box office success, accounting for about two-thirds of its total revenue. Shah Rukh Khan's rendition in Hindi has been particularly well-received, drawing massive audiences and positioning itself as the leading version among the dubs. Following closely is the Telugu dub, featuring Mahesh Babu, which alone garnered Rs 2 crore on its debut day. This remarkable performance underscores the influence of local star power in attracting audiences to theaters, especially in Andhra Pradesh and Telangana.
The film's opening success is further underscored by its performance relative to its predecessor, The Lion King, and its reception across different Indian states. While The Lion King saw a significant jump in its collections from Friday to Sunday, Mufasa's trajectory might differ due to the unique box office dynamics in the regions where the Telugu version is popular. Despite this, the Hindi and English versions are expected to see growth during the weekend, bolstered by the star appeal of Shah Rukh Khan and Mahesh Babu in their respective dubs.
Industry analysts are optimistic about Mufasa's financial journey, projecting an opening weekend collection of around Rs 30 crore nett.
